In Galatians 2:1-14, Paul continued his personal story about his interaction with the leaders in Jerusalem, relating that they completely supported his message and ministry. He recounted these events in detail in order to defend the gospel and protect the unity of the church. It is still true today that we can maintain unity amidst great cultural diversity only if we hold on to the one and only gospel.
